THE LAST TIME
-The day I saw you last time
Everyone was teary eyed
My heart said, see him completely
Because it is going to be the last time
-The day I went on a walk with you
A sunny day and you observing something new
I knew it was my class time
But I went with you, not knowing
It is going to be the last time
-Early morning, me opening the gate for you
With a sleepy face and a big smile
But I was all ears
When you talked about life
Wish I knew it was the last time
-Still listen those call recordings
Between me and you, comforting you
Knowing it is going to be the last time
Me talking to you
-From you taking care of me to,
Me taking care of you
A beautiful journey passed
I miss you
And it’s never going to be the last time
Me thinking about you
